Kleinman Holocaust Education Center Inc. (EIN: 27-0644792)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2016 IRS Form 990 filing, Kleinman Holocaust Education Center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 2 out of 13 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$227,939. The highest compensated employee at Kleinman Holocaust Education Center Inc. is Raymond Friedman with fiscal year 2016 compensation of $253,244.

Mission Statement

KLEINMAN HOLOCAUST EDUCATION CENTER, INC. ("KHEC") IS A PUBLIC CHARITY THAT IS FORMED TO EXPEND, CONTRIBUTE, DISBURSE AND OTHERWISE DISPOSE OF ITS MONEY, INCOME AND OTHER PROPERTY TO TEACH THE HISTORY OF THE HOLOCAUST, THE LESSONS TO BE LEARNED THERE FROM; AND TO PROVIDE INFORMATION, BOOKS AND OTHER EDUCATIONAL MATERIALS RELATIVE THERETO. KHEC IS SUPPORTED PRIMARILY THROUGH DONOR CONTRIBUTIONS.
